Knowledge Powers Development With Mobile Solutions

Digital Transformation FR, MISES À JOUR, Sécurité alimentaire et nutritionnelle|

Many farmers have very limited access to information, causing poor farming practice and low productivity in sub-Saharan Africa. This rice and cocoa value chain example demonstrates how mobile based ICT solutions can contribute to closing the knowledge gap.

How Can Social Protection Contribute to Drought Resilience?

MISES À JOUR, Sécurité alimentaire et nutritionnelle|

Social protection tools are becoming a popular policy response. DIE and GIZ co-organised a panel to discuss evidence demonstrating that regular income transfers allow people to better meet their immediate basic consumption needs and enable them to save for hard times.

Launched in 1995 in Lesotho, the Sector Network Rural Development Africa today deals with all aspects related rural development and sustainable management of natural resources in Africa. In addition, rural development issues are linked to broader aspects of economic development as well as good governance processes.
